04/03/2024 @ 11:00 am – 12:00 pm –
With the most significant changes in social housing regulation for over a decade due to be implemented imminently, and a greater focus than ever on the obligations on local authorities to provide safe, secure and decent homes, this webinar will explore what is required of local authorities under the revised Consumer Standards including:
– Key changes in the requirements of the Consumer Standards
– Tenant engagement requirements
– Ensuring appropriate oversight and accountability of compliance
– The approach of the Regulator
– Lessons learned from recent regulatory notices

15/04/2024 @ 2:00 pm – 3:00 pm –
This webinar will focus on:
– What agreements, policies and procedures may need to be reviewed and updated in light of the changes to the Consumer Standards
– Key governance considerations, including the roles and responsibilities of H&S and Consumer Standards leads
– The proposed approach of the Regulator to gradings and regulatory action, and how might link to triggers under funding agreements
